Establishing Your Professional Presence: The Value of a Prestigious Business Address in Canada

Picture of Jack L.
Jack L.

Partner & Manager

In a world where first impressions can make or break business opportunities, the prestige of a business address in a recognized Canadian city becomes invaluable. It’s more than just a location on a map – it’s a signal to clients, partners, and competitors that says your business is serious, trustworthy, and established. Canada, with its stable economy and positive international reputation, offers business addresses that confer these benefits.

The Power of Perception

Perception is a pivotal component of success in any industry. Having a business address in a prestigious area within Canadian metropolitan centers such as Toronto, Vancouver, or Montreal adds an air of significance and perceived value to a company. It inherently associates the business with a level of success and influence, much in the same way an address from Silicon Valley or Wall Street might. A distinguished business address can serve as a form of branding, an intangible asset that supports the company’s reputation and aids in establishing its position within the market. Clients are more likely to engage with a business that is situated in a noteworthy location, as it suggests stability, credibility, and permanence.

Strategic Networking and Opportunities

A premier business address in Canada places you at the heart of a bustling commercial hub. It’s not merely about geography; it’s about being part of a dynamic business community. Such locations often brim with networking possibilities, industry events, and potential partnerships. They serve as central nodes where ideas flow and collaborations flourish. Being located in a prominent district means more than accessible amenities; it signals your business’s access to cutting-edge industry developments and opens doorways to strategic alliances. It’s where being present can mean a world of difference in securing deals and fostering relationships that propel business growth.

Economic Advantages and International Recognition

The importance of a Canadian business address extends into the international arena. In an interconnected global economy, Canada’s reputation for stability, strong governance, and favorable business environment makes it an attractive base for operations. This recognition affords businesses with Canadian addresses an advantage when dealing with international partners who are familiar with Canada’s prestige. Furthermore, some Canadian addresses can also offer businesses financial perks. Certain provinces offer tax advantages or incentives that could be beneficial for businesses. Coupled with the international respect, the economic benefits of a prestigious Canadian address can support business expansion both domestically and internationally.

Leveraging Virtual Solutions for Prestige

In the digital age, physical office space in premium locations can come at a prohibitive cost. However, virtual offices have democratized access to prestigious addresses. Businesses can establish a presence in sought-after Canadian locations without the overhead of traditional office space. This approach enhances professional image and presence while maintaining operational flexibility and efficiency. By leveraging virtual office solutions, even startups and small enterprises can project the image of an established company with a stately address. These solutions offer not just a mailing address but also often include additional services such as mail forwarding, a local phone number, and access to meeting spaces, which further add to the professional image of a business.

Conclusion: A Mark of Distinction

In conclusion, a prestigious Canadian business address is more than a location for mail; it’s a strategic asset for any business. It’s a mark of distinction that amplifies the perception of reliability and success. While the physicality of business location might have evolved with the rise of remote work and digital services, the value of a prestigious address remains undiminished. It serves as a key differentiator in a crowded market, offering both tangible and intangible benefits that can elevate a company’s status and facilitate its path to success.

Table of Contents